iText Pro is a cute, intuitive, and refined yet flexible text editor with word processing.
iText Pro is iText Express with many more nicely enhanced features. This is what adds to its flexibility and compatibility.
iText Pro follows the original simplicity of Macs, so it works perfectly with every feature of TextEdit basics and Microsoft(R) Word compatibility, as well as iText Express.
iText Pro also has lots of functional and attractive features it shares with word processor.
Besides all the iText Express basics,
the items shown below are the special additions to iText Express.
* Various extra commands for advanced editing;
Change Case, Shift Right or left, Automatic Indent, Underline Cursor Indication, and Customizable Japanese-wrap.
* Multiple Clipboards
* Even faster File Search with the file browser
* Hierarchical bookmarks
* Extreme sensitive style selections;
Ruby, Various Underlines / Strikethroughs / Highlights, Emphasis Dots, and Horizontally in Vertical
* Multiple Windows of the same file
* Indicates Line Numbers
* Variable Document Width to wrap lines;
Fit lines into Window width or Page width, or Do not Wrap Lines not to accommodate lines to the window size.
* Helpful Alignment additions to arrange the lines for '.epub eBooks' viewing;
Change Align Left to Justify / Change Justify to Align Left
* Customizable keyboard shortcuts
* Customizable Toolbar
* Customizable Templates
